Harvey Spencer Lewis, born on November twenty-fifth, eighteen eighty-three, was a prominent American journalist, writer, and mystic. He is best known for his role as the founder of the Ancient Mystical Order Rosae Crucis (AMORC), an organization dedicated to the study and practice of Rosicrucian teachings.
In nineteen fifteen, Lewis established AMORC and took on the mantle of its first leader, known as the imperator. His leadership spanned several decades, during which he significantly influenced the spread of Rosicrucian philosophy and mysticism across the United States and beyond.
Throughout his life, Lewis was not only a prolific writer but also a dedicated seeker of spiritual knowledge. His works continue to inspire those interested in the mystical and esoteric traditions, reflecting his deep commitment to the principles of Rosicrucianism.
